@lauram1165586 · Camped on Aug 28, 2025 at Campsite #32
FYI; site 32 has no trees to provide shade when its the heat of the day. Wouldve been peaceful had not another camper been grinding away at his RV for hours then called a repair RV company to fix what he had done. Campground has opening to river; however, its super shallow and not swimmable. Good knee depth. Other than that, it was great!

@DeirdreB592898 · Camped on Jul 21, 2021 at Campsite #32
I had high hopes for our stay at Schwarz Park. However, the information online about this campground is misleading. It is not on Dorena Lake, but on a small creek that was once connected to the lake and is now dammed. There is no lake access from the campground, you have to drive to get there. Also on our first and only morning there a crew of landscapers came through the campground around 10:30 am and mowed the area leaving all the families trying to enjoy a peaceful morning at camp in a cloud of dust and debris. Everything in our site was covered in dirt and grass clippings. I asked them to move to a different area and they were very rude and another one of them came close to my site and spewed even more dust all over my and my sons belongings. All our kitchen supplies were filthy and we had dirt in our eyes and mouths. I attempted to get a refund for the night but the volunteer was unable to help me and I havent heard from the park staff even though the volunteer said she would contact the higher ups and get back to me. We definitely will not be returning.
